Bruno Mars rolls into their Park Theater residency within the Las Vegas Strip this weekend break fresh off the iHeartRadio Honours, where he somewhat grudgingly took home the Head Award. “It’s a little sarcastic for me, because I really feel like I’m just starting out, ” he said, prior to closing the show along with recent hits “Treasure” as well as “That’s What I Like”-and after that breaking into an all out groove session with Sarasota Georgia Line, Thomas Rhett, Ty Dolla $ign and much more.

Mars is turning into the person when it comes to big-party awards display performances; his fans continue to be clamoring about February’s Grammy Awards, when he donned magenta sequins and played the white Schecter Cloud acoustic guitar in tribute to Knight in shining armor. Some were shocked to understand Bruno can shred-and other people might wish he’d in no way attempted to play the iconic acoustic guitar solo from “Let’s Proceed Crazy”-but the performance remaining a lasting impression either way. Mars is a phenomenal talent, the singer and songwriter who else effortlessly crosses genres, the well-rounded entertainer coming into their own as a showman and bandleader.
